Summary: Monster, a book for everyone
Comment: Monster is a book about a boy who is convicted of a crime. The boy believes and tries to convince everyone that he is innocent, but even his lawyer is in doubt. Walter Dean Myers leaves the reader to decide whether the boy is innocent or not. Steve, the boy convicted of murder, has the hobby of writing movie scripts, and there isnt a better movie to write than his own sad life, but yet exciting and suspenseful life. The reader is learning about his life similar to the way the watchers of his movies would be. This book is recommended to anyone who enjoys reading at all and esspecially those who need a break because this book is easy and fun to read.
